Transaction 0758f863430d553942b9d060f140c975d619a7b21b569e903fa73da5fc1b71a0
1 Input
1 Output
-
0758f863430d553942b9d060f140c975d619a7b21b569e903fa73da5fc1b71a0:0
- value
- 1581195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5647bddfe7e01eacf89ee1923bb107591915ff4 OP_EQUAL
- address
- 3Q4XrHN2BYdZcVU8mrfffKQjiDdXi69uuS